The image, when properly oriented, captures a roadside scene under an overcast daytime sky. A paved asphalt road, marked with a white dividing line, extends from the foreground into the distance on the right. To the left of the road, a yellow curb borders a white concrete barrier. This barrier is distinctly painted with the red, yellow, and blue horizontal stripes of the Venezuelan flag.

Partial text visible on the barrier reads "MIRADOR TURÍSTICO" (Tourist Viewpoint) and "GUANTE", suggesting a specific named location or area. A low stone wall runs along the base of this painted barrier, with green grass and sparse vegetation growing behind it.

The left side of the scene features several palm trees, with one large, mature palm tree prominently positioned in the mid-ground. Another smaller palm is visible towards the bottom left. Behind the road and barrier, a steep hillside rises, densely covered with a mix of green and drier-looking trees and shrubs. Further back on the hillside, a tall metal power pylon and associated power lines are visible. A street light pole with dual lamps stands behind the concrete barrier, near the hillside.

No human activity is depicted in the scene. The weather is overcast, contributing to soft, diffused lighting. The flag colors and text strongly indicate a location in Venezuela, consistent with the provided context of Tacarigua. The scene portrays a scenic, rugged landscape, likely a viewpoint or section of road in a hilly or mountainous region.
